html,body,html *{font-family:Roboto,sans-serif}.oc-leaflet-container{width:100%;height:100lvh;display:flex}.oc-leaflet-column{scrollbar-width:thin;scrollbar-color:#ddd #fdfdfd;padding:0;overflow:scroll}.oc-leaflet-column>h2{margin-top:8px;margin-bottom:0;margin-left:12px}.oc-leaflet-column>ul{flex-direction:column;gap:0;padding-inline-start:0;display:flex}.oc-leaflet-column>ul>li{cursor:pointer;text-align:left;background-color:#fdfdfd;padding:12px 20px;transition:background-color .2s,padding .2s;display:block}.oc-leaflet-column>ul>li:hover{background-color:#f4f4f4;padding:12px}.oc-leaflet-column>ul>li>h4{color:#222;pointer-events:none;margin:0;font-size:16px;font-weight:400;line-height:20px;display:inline-block}.oc-leaflet-column>ul>li>p{color:#aaa;pointer-events:none;margin-top:8px;margin-bottom:0}.oc-leaflet-location-selected{background-color:#f4f4f4!important}.oc-leaflet-map{width:100%;height:100%}
